    • @Matthew Scearce The best advice I can give you is get to where you're hunting at least 20 min before first light. Just listen to see if you hear one gobble. If you do make sure you set up 50 yards farther than he could even possibly see you. Then call a bit while he is still in the tree. You will hear him fly down once he does keep him talking and change up your calls a couple times slate, reed, box call what ever you have. When he gets closer just use a mouth call and be vary still.

    • So there's obviously alotta landowners I've found to be harder than other's towards granting me access to hunting their property. I used to believe that they were just hateful and mean towards hunting and hunters, when in reality most are really nice people that have simply been done wrong by "hunters" that they've given permission to hunt in the past. If you'll explain to them your "wants" to hunt their property and your passion for the outdoors that can sway them. You can simply introduce yourself and say you've got some beautiful property that I'd love to hunt, tell them a little about yourself, and let them know that you don't need an immediate answer. Tell them you'll stop back by in 3 or 4 days to give them some time to think it over and talk to their husband or wife about it.. It takes the pressure off of them to give you a flat out yes or no answer on the spot. Example, farmer John says of course you can hunt it, and you think to yourself awesome only to pull up the evening before opening morning to rooste a bird and good ole farmer John says well buddy i know i told you yes but I'm sorry to say that the wife isn't too thrilled about it. That's basically a no for those of you that might not be married.😂 They say hell hath no furry like the wrath of a woman, or something like that. All of this of course works best a week or 2 before season actually starts. And, if i feel like a property owner is leaning on the fence a little when it comes to saying yes I'll really step it up a notch and say tell ya what I'll do, I'll have a Hold Harmless Agreement packet written up and signed by "you" the landowner and myself. This is done by a professional attorney. You can Google it, but in short it's basically saying that they aren't liable if something happens to you while on their property. Alotta times that'll sweeten the deal as we're living in a sue crazy world. I've learned a few tricks and tactics in my 36 years of deer and turkey hunting. Oh and never get frustrated if someone still says no, keep asking around, be prepared and have a full tank of gas and make a day of it. I'll on average pick up at least 3 or 4 places if i ask say 20 people in a day. And, to all of you who've never asked and might be intimidated don't be, the worst they can say is get the hell off my property. That sometimes happens too, but you never know unless you ask.
